比特币钱包同步区块的必要性解析

      发布时间:2024-11-29 10:30:00

      比特币作为一种去中心化的数字货币,其交易的安全性和透明性得益于区块链技术。而比特币钱包则是用户存储、接收和发送比特币的工具。在使用比特币钱包时,很多用户可能会问:比特币钱包需要同步块吗?答案是肯定的,尤其是对于全节点钱包而言,块的同步是必不可少的。下面就来详细解析比特币钱包为何需要同步区块,以及相关的技术机制、影响因素等。

      一、比特币钱包的工作原理

      比特币钱包的主要功能是进行比特币的存储和交易。比特币钱包并不是实际存储比特币,而是存储用户的私钥。私钥是可以用来签署交易的,这一点至关重要。用户所有的比特币交易记录都存储在区块链网络上。因此,比特币钱包通过与区块链进行交互,来查询余额和发送交易。

      为了实现这一点,比特币钱包需要一个完整的节点(全节点钱包)来存储区块链的所有数据,或者可以选择轻量型钱包(SPV钱包),它们不下载完整的区块链,而是仅下载必要的区块头信息。这就引出一个核心全节点钱包需要同步块,而SPV钱包在某种程度上依赖于全节点的服务。

      二、比特币钱包同步块的必要性

      1. **完整性与安全性:** 对于全节点用户来说,同步区块是为了保证钱包中记录的比特币余额和交易状态是最新的。比特币网络是动态的,时刻有新的交易和区块被添加到区块链中。因此,只有实时同步区块,才能确保钱包中的信息与区块链的真实状态一致,从而避免用户因信息滞后而导致的资金损失。

      2. **防止双重支付:** 比特币的区块链设计防止了双重支付的问题。如果不及时同步区块,钱包可能会认为某一笔交易尚未确认并重新发送,这样可能导致双重支付情况的发生。而定期与网络同步,确保本地记录与网络版本的一致性,有助于有效避免这一问题。

      3. **交易历史记录:** 同步区块还可以让用户查看到所有的交易历史记录,不仅限于用户自己发起的交易,还有其他相关交易。通过区块链提供透明的交易历史,用户可以追溯自己的资金流向,从而加强对资金的控制和监管。

      三、同步块的技术机制

      比特币区块链是通过一个去中心化的网络来维护的。每个节点都保存着一个副本,其中包括所有的交易记录。当用户使用全节点钱包时,它会从网络中获取最新的区块并进行验证。

      1. **区块下载:** 当用户启动全节点钱包后,它会向网络中的其他节点请求最新的区块信息。区块是以链的形式存在,每个区块都包含了前一个区块的哈希,因此,节点在下载最新区块的同时,也必须下载之前所有的区块。

      2. **验证与存储:** 下载块后,节点会对区块中的交易进行验证,确保交易的合法性和有效性。如果所有的数据都匹配,节点将会把这些区块存储到本地,并更新其交易记录。

      四、轻量钱包与全节点的对比

      轻量钱包(SPV钱包)与全节点钱包的主要区别在于对区块的同步方式及程度。轻量钱包并不下载整个区块链,而是仅下载块头及必要的信息。这意味着轻量钱包的更新速度更快,但也存在一些安全风险。

      1. **安全性:** 全节点钱包能够独立验证每笔交易,确保不会受到恶意服务的干扰。而轻量钱包需要依赖全节点提供的服务,安全性上则有一定的折损。

      2. **存储要求:** 全节点钱包需要大量的存储空间来存储整个区块链,尤其是当区块链持续增长时。而轻量钱包只需存储较小数据量,这对用户的硬件配置要求相对较少。

      3. **使用体验:** 由于轻量钱包不需要长时间的同步过程,用户在体验上可能会更加便捷。但这一便捷性也伴随着对全节点的依赖,因此无法确保完全的自主操作。

      五、如何选择合适的钱包类型

      选择合适的钱包类型主要取决于用户的需求与技术背景。对于技术较强,且对安全性有较高要求的用户,推荐使用全节点钱包,它能提供更高的安全性以及隐私保护。而对于技术要求较低的普通用户,则可以选择轻量钱包,因其使用较为简单且方便。

      六、影响同步速度的因素

      1. **网络带宽:** 同步速度往往受到用户网络带宽的影响。带宽越大,同步的速度便会越快。不同地区网速差异可能会导致用户在同步过程中的不便。

      2. **节点数量:** 比特币网络是一个去中心化的生态系统,节点的数量与分布状况也会影响到同步的效率。更多的公共节点能够提供更快的响应时间,从而加快同步进程。

      3. **节点性能:** 用户自己设备的性能(例如CPU、内存等)也会影响同步的速度。如果设备性能较低,同时运行多个程序,将会耗费较多的计算资源,因此同步速度可能会下降。

      七、常见问题解答

      在使用比特币钱包的过程中,用户常常会对于同步相关的问题感到疑惑,以下是一些常见的问题及其解答:

      比特币钱包同步块的速度慢怎么办?

      在使用比特币钱包时,用户经常会遇到同步速度慢的情况,尤其是在初次运行全节点钱包的过程中。此时,用户可以采取以下措施:

      1. **提高网络带宽:** 使用更快速的网络连接,能有效提高数据下载的速度。

      2. **选择高性能的节点:** 尝试连接多个其他节点,查看是否有更快的节点可用。同时,在设置中添加一些高性能的公共节点,有助于提升同步速度。

      3. **设备性能:** 确保设备的CPU与内存能够承载运行比特币钱包,关闭其他消耗资源的程序,释放系统资源来加速同步。

      如何安全使用比特币钱包?

      安全性是使用比特币钱包的首要考虑,下面是一些保障钱包安全的措施:

      1. **定期备份钱包:** 使用比特币钱包时,确保定期备份私钥与钱包文件,以防因设备损坏导致损失。

      2. **使用硬件钱包:** 对于高频交易用户,建议使用硬件钱包,它具有更高的安全性,能有效抵御各种网络攻击。

      3. **开启双重认证:** 在支持的情况下,开启双重认证,能为比特币交易提供额外的安全保护,进一步降低风险。

      比特币钱包可以选择哪些类型?

      比特币钱包有多种类型,用户可以根据需求选择合适的类型:

      1. **全节点钱包:** 适合技术背景较强的用户,能够安全地独立交易,具备完整的隐私保护。

      2. **轻量钱包(SPV钱包):** 适合普通用户,使用便捷,但需依赖其他节点提供服务,安全性相对较低。

      3. **硬件钱包:** 提供最高的安全性,适合持有大量比特币的用户,是保护数字资产的良好选择。

      如何恢复丢失的比特币钱包?

      如果用户丢失了比特币钱包,不用慌张。只要备份了私钥或助记词,用户可以通过以下步骤恢复钱包:

      1. **找到备份:** 使用之前备份的私钥或助记词,可以通过钱包软件恢复钱包地址。

      2. **安装钱包:** 在新的设备上安装相应的钱包软件,进入恢复选项,输入私钥或助记词。

      3. **验证恢复:** 钱包恢复完成后,检查余额和交易记录,确保所有信息均正常显示。

      挖矿与钱包的关系如何?

      挖矿和钱包在比特币生态中扮演着不同但又紧密相连的角色:

      1. **钱包:** 比特币钱包的功能是存储比特币及管理交易,而挖矿则是为了生成新块,确认交易并维护网络的安全。

      2. **挖矿获取比特币:** 通过挖矿,用户可以获得比特币奖励,这些比特币将存入用户的钱包中,用于未来的交易和使用。

      3. **操作互补:** 挖矿需要将获得的比特币存入钱包以便管理,而比特币钱包用户则能在市场中花费或交易其持有的比特币,推动市场流动性。

      综合来看,比特币钱包与同步区块密不可分。用户应选择合适的钱包类型,并提升操作的安全性与存储策略。了解比特币网络的工作原理和常见问题,将有助于用户更高效地管理和使用自己的数字资产。

      分享 :
        author

        tpwallet

        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                        相关新闻

                                        比特币钱包的种子(Seed)
                                        2024-11-07
                                        比特币钱包的种子(Seed)

                                        随着加密货币的迅速发展,比特币作为最早也是最具影响力的数字货币,越来越多的人开始关注和使用比特币钱包。...

                                        比特币下载到钱包的安全
                                        2025-01-21
                                        比特币下载到钱包的安全

                                        比特币(Bitcoin)作为一种具有高流动性和价值储存属性的数字货币,近年来越来越受到用户的关注。从最初的媒体炒...

                                        全面解析Haobtc:国内领先
                                        2024-12-03
                                        全面解析Haobtc:国内领先

                                        在数字货币迅猛发展的今天,各种数字资产的管理与存储显得尤为重要。比特币作为最早也是最知名的数字货币,其...

                                        虚拟币存放钱包全攻略:
                                        2025-02-18
                                        虚拟币存放钱包全攻略:

                                        随着虚拟币(加密货币)的广泛普及,越来越多的人开始关注如何安全、便捷地存放自己手中的虚拟币。了解如何将...